Loudoun County Public Schools ranks number three on the list of school systems in Virginia. Located in Ashburn, the public school has a student population of 83,606 in grades PK, K-12. LCPS is a part of Loudoun County and is in charge of the administrations of the public schools in Loudoun County.

Loudoun County Schools is one of the fastest-growing school counties in Virginia. The population of Loudoun County schools is expected to see an increase in the coming years. Every year, Loudoun County public schools establish one to three new educational facilities to contain the increasing population of students.

The school is operated daily by the educational superintendent (Dr.) Scott A Zieglar. However, the school system is under the authority of the Loudoun County School Board. The school board is a nine-member panel instituted through public elections by the citizens of Loudoun.

Loudoun County Schools have a student-to-teacher ratio of 14:1, with 86% of students proficient in maths and 84% proficient in reading.

According to Niche.com, Loudoun County Schools scores an overall general A rating. Out of 131 school districts, Loudoun is the second-best school county in Athletics and the fifth-best district in Virginia. Loudoun County is also the seventh safest school district in Virginia.  

Loudoun County Public Schools students earned 1,173 average SAT scores (maths=581 and reading=592). The county has an impressive graduation rate of 96.8%. in 2020, the school county produced a total of 54 National Merit semi-finalists and earned over 48.2 million dollars in scholarship funds.

While accreditation was waived in 2020 by the Virginia Department of Education (VDOE) because of the pandemic, it is essential to note that all LCPS school is fully accredited. There are ninety-seven educational facilities under Loudoun County Public Schools and they include:

  • Eighteen high schools
  • Seventeen middle schools
  • Sixty elementary schools
  • Two centers for education (The North Star School and Academies of Loudoun)

Enrolment Requirements

Step-By-Step Registration Guide for Loudoun County Public Schools

Step One—Eligibility  

  • Verification of Age Eligibility

The intending student must be five years old before or on the 30th of September of the school year to qualify for enrolment into the kindergarten class. There is no exemption from this state requirement. Also, some students less than 20 years on or before the first of August of the school year may receive an extension.

  • Evidence of Residency

Parents or legal guardians must provide evidence of residency. In the case where the child is not residing with the parents or a legal guardian, reference can be made to the Special Registration Criteria for more information about registering the child. There are different schools zoned for different parts of Loudoun. Therefore, students need to ensure that their choice of school is within the attendance zone.

Loudoun County Public Schools system may request for re-confirmation of residency every annual re-enrollment of a child. Parents/legal guardians that intend to register their child/ward in a school in another attendance zone, must first register the child in a school within their zone before requesting Special Permission.

Parents/legal guardians can access the Special Registration Situation for more information and considerations.

Step Two–Documentation

  • Proof of Age

Parents/legal guardians must provide a certified birth certificate of their child/ward.

  • Proof of Identity

Parents/guardians must provide verifiable proof of identity with their names and evidence of address.

  • Proof of Immunization 

Parents must provide proof of their child’s immunization history from a government health center or a certified pediatrician.

Step Three—Complete the Registration Process

Parents may decide to finish their registration online or submit hand-filled paper documents at their choice school (within the attendance zone). For a list of Attendance zones, parents can visit the following link.

Download the registration documents for paper registration forms. Parents can also visit their chosen school to collect registration packets for their children. For online registration, the parent must register a ParentVUE account by visiting the Online Pre-registration page for information, registration guide, and resources.

Step Four—Book a Registration Appointment

Once online pre-registration is complete and all necessary documents are collected, parents/legal guardians must contact the child’s zoned school to book an appointment to conclude the registration process. The parent or legal guardian of the child must submit all necessary documents to the school in person.

Tuition Fees for Loudoun County Schools

  • Parents and legal guardians can request Tuition fees using the Tuition Request Form. The approval of tuition requests depends on the availability of space in the choice school.
  • There are no waiver and siblings scale fees.
  • Once the request is sent to the school, the school will work together with the Business and Financial Service office to generate a tailored invoice in line with the duration of the request. Parents/ legal guardians will then make payments upon receipt of the invoice. Payments can be made using cash, check, or money order. Credit cards/debit cards and ACH transactions are also acceptable means of fees payment.

For questions, information, and payment schedules, parents can reach the office of Business and Financial Services via 571-252-1190 from Monday to Friday between the working hours of 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M. 

Tuition rates for the 2022-22 session are:

In-State Residents will pay a yearly fee of $12,350 while out-of-state residents will pay a yearly fee of $17,894.
